The postcode DL9 3AA is located in Richmondshire, in the county of North Yorkshire. It was introduced in January 1980 and is an active postcode. DL9 3AA is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).

DL9 3AA is one of the less de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 6.7 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of DL9 3AA as Hard-pressed living > Challenged terraced workers > Deprived blue-collar terraces.

The closest road name to DL9 3AA is Menin Road which is centered 47 m away.

The nearest bus stop is Cambrai Crossroads and is 305 m away.

The closest primary school to DL9 3AA (for ages 11 and under) is Carnagill Community Primary School. The closest secondary school (for ages 11-18) is Richmond School. The last OFSTED inspection on January 19, 2022 rated this school as Good

The local pub for residents of DL9 3AA is Richmond Rugby Club and is 2.57 km away.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) rated it as Very Good on March 13, 2019. The nearest takeaway food is available from Barries Ices and is 2.54 km distant. The FSA rated this establishment as Very Good on April 22, 2022.

Residents reported an average download speed of 46.4 Mbps and an average upload speed of 12.5 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 100% of residents have broadband access of superfast 30-300 Mbps.

Gas consumption for the area is rated at 2.1 out of 10. Electricity consumption for the area is rated at 0.5 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.

Policing for DL9 3AA is covered by the North Yorkshire police force association and North Yorkshire and York is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
